I wonder how many aspiring software engineers actually think that editing in vim and installing hyprland on Arch are sort of the "pro" skills they should master to be good at their potential job instead of like playing with gitlab-ci, understanding build systems and testing frameworks, or learning how to troubleshoot systems.
Speaking of troubleshooting BTW, there's this cool website sadservers.com where you can solve puzzles around working with and troubleshooting Linux and common tools like docker, databases and reverse proxies
